Modern Foreign Languages Teacher (French & Spanish)
Are you passionate about languages and eager to inspire the next generation of linguists?
We are seeking a
dynamic and enthusiastic French and Spanish Teacher
to join our vibrant and forward-thinking MFL department at a well-regarded secondary school in
Croydon
the role is Part time Monday to Wednesday.
About the Role:
You will be responsible for delivering engaging and high-quality lessons in
both French and Spanish
across Key Stages 3 and 4. The ideal candidate will be able to foster a love of languages in students of all abilities and contribute positively to the wider school community.
Key Responsibilities:
Plan and deliver creative lessons in French and Spanish.
Monitor student progress and provide constructive feedback.
Support students in achieving strong outcomes at GCSE level.
Collaborate with colleagues in curriculum development and extracurricular activities.
Uphold high standards of teaching and learning.
The Ideal Candidate Will Have:
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or equivalent.
Experience teaching both French and Spanish at secondary level.
A strong subject knowledge and a passion for language learning.
Excellent classroom management and communication skills.
A commitment to inclusive education and high student achievement.
